National Bank of Canada FI grew its holdings in shares of LPL Financial Holdings Inc. (NASDAQ:LPLA - Free Report) by 300.5% in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The fund owned 1,462 shares of the financial services provider's stock after buying an additional 1,097 shares during the quarter. National Bank of Canada FI's holdings in LPL Financial were worth $477,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

LPL Financial Holdings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ides an integrated platform of brokerage and investment advisory services to independent financial advisors and financial advisors at enterprises in the United States. Its brokerage offerings include variable and fixed annuities, mutual funds, equities, fixed income, alternative investments, retirement and 529 education savings plans, and insurance.
